WebDinagat Islands belong to one of the poorest regions in the country and are considered as one of the most geographically isolated and disadvantaged areas. According to the Philippines Statistics Authority, its poverty incidence is at 30.3% as of first half of 2024, which means that almost one-third of its population is living below the poverty ...
WebAug 21, 2024 · In 2024, the island accounted for 59% of the country’s total sugarcane production and 48% of the total area harvested. Of the 27 operational mills in the country, 12 are in Negros, which produced 63% of the country’s total raw sugar in 2024. But life in the island is bitter – poverty incidence is consistently higher than the national figure. WebJan 2, 2024 · The Philippines is one of the most vulnerable countries to disaster and climate change. With over 7,000 islands and over 36,000 kilometers of coastline, nearly everyone – 74 percent of the population – and everywhere – 80 percent of the land area – is vulnerable to disaster, with the capital of Manila considered at “extreme risk.”.
